How to Create SEO Friendly URLs

Creating SEO friendly URLs involves following certain best practices and considerations, including:

URL Best Practices

  • Keep URLs short and concise, ideally no longer than 3-5 words.
  • Use hyphens (-) to separate words in URLs, as they are more readable and SEO friendly than underscores or spaces.
  • Use lowercase letters in URLs to ensure consistency and avoid potential case sensitivity issues.
  • Include target keywords in URLs to signal relevance to search engines and improve keyword visibility.
  • Avoid including dates in URLs unless they are essential for the content, as they can make URLs appear outdated and less evergreen.
  • Organize URLs into logical navigation structures and subfolders to improve website hierarchy and user experience.
  • Ensure that your website uses HTTPS protocol to provide a secure browsing experience and boost trustworthiness.

Best Practices for SEO Friendly URLs

Short URLs

Short URLs are easier to read, remember, and share, making them more user-friendly and SEO friendly. Aim to keep your URLs concise and focused on the main topic or keyword of the page.

Hyphens in URLs

Hyphens are preferred over underscores or spaces in URLs because they are treated as word separators by search engines. Use hyphens to separate words in URLs and improve readability and SEO performance.

Lowercase Letters in URLs

Consistency is key in URL structure. Always use lowercase letters in URLs to avoid potential case sensitivity issues and ensure uniformity across your website.

Avoiding Dates in URLs

Unless dates are essential to the content or context of the page, it’s best to avoid including them in URLs. Dated URLs can make content appear outdated and less relevant to users, impacting SEO performance.

URL Navigation & Subfolders

Organize your URLs into logical navigation structures and subfolders to improve website hierarchy and user experience. Use descriptive subfolder names to categorize and group related content together.

HTTPS and URLs

Ensure that your website uses HTTPS protocol to provide a secure browsing experience for users. HTTPS is a ranking factor in Google’s algorithm and can improve your website’s trustworthiness and search engine visibility.

Dynamic URL Parameters

Be mindful of dynamic URL parameters that can create multiple variations of the same URL. Use URL parameters sparingly and implement canonical tags to consolidate duplicate content and prevent indexing issues.

Subfolders vs. Subdomains for SEO

When structuring your website, consider whether to use subfolders or subdomains for organizing content. Subfolders are generally preferred for SEO, as they consolidate authority and link equity, while subdomains can dilute SEO efforts.
